About the Agency

The Mississippi Department of Human Services is dedicated to serving others while providing a wide range of public assistance programs, social services, and support for children, low-income individuals and families. The agency seeks to empower families so they can become self-sufficient and responsible for their future success. This position is with the Division of Community Services and will be located in STATE OFFICE. If you have any questions, you may contact us at mdhsrecruitment@mdhs.ms.gov.

About the Position

This position will work the Weatherization Assistance Program inside of the Division of Community Services and will be responsible for the following duties: Analyzing Monthly and Quarterly Reports and submitting them to the Program and Division Director. Reviewing, analyzing and processing subgrants/modifications for the Dept. Of Energy's Weatherization Assistance Programs and the LIHEAP WX programs for the division. Assisting in preparing the DOE WX State Plans, LIHEAP WX State Plans, Notice of Funding Availability (NOFAs) for WX Subgrantees (similar to Request for Proposals-RFPs), state and federal reports for both programs. Annual filings with the MS Attorney General's Office and MS Secretary of State's Office. Oversees the reviews and enter reports into the DOE WX Performance and Accountability for Grants in Energy (PAGE). Assisting Program Director in Administrative training for Community Services staff and WX Subgrantees on WX policies, procedures, rules and regulations as well as participate in trainings offered by DOE WX. Staying abreast of all WX policies and procedures, notifications and maintaining accurate files for the program. Serves in the absence of the WX Program Director on Administrative issues/concerns. And other related or similar duties as required or assigned. **This is a non-state service, time-limited position with The Mississippi Department of Human Services.**

What you'll need to be Successful

Excellent written and oral communication skills, proficient in Microsoft Office Suite and demonstrable experience in completing programmatic reviews. Demonstrate the ability to research and solve complex issues. Ability to maintain confidentiality and develop and maintain relationships.
